Background and purpose 1.1 Background According to the latest national waste statistics (2014), about 84,000 tonnes of plastic waste are collected from Danish households and commercial enterprises each year. Hereof, about 32,000 tonnes are municipal waste, of which 50% come from recycling stations and 50% come from household collection schemes, and 52,000 tonnes are industrial waste. In addition, there is a large quantity of plastic waste which is not yet separated at source. Hence, it is estimated that there potentially is an additional 150,000 tonnes to 200,000 tonnes of plastic waste from Danish households each year. The project aims to create a market for recycling of plastic waste from households and similar types of industrial plastic waste from commercial enterprises. The waste stream from these sources will include plastic packaging, large plastic products from bulky household waste (from recycling stations) as well as other types of plastic waste from commercial activities (e.g. from recycling stations, small enterprises participating in the municipal collection schemes and facilities for preliminary sorting). In addition, the waste stream will also include a mixed plastic and metal fraction from households. The tender builds on the recommendations of the Innovation Platform for Plastics, which CLEAN conducted in 2013 with participation from more than 100 Danish plastics companies and experts in the field. The platform concluded that a tender should be prepared for separation of household plastic waste and similar plastic waste from enterprises. The challenges include: a lack of an overall supply of plastic waste from households and companies, but also uncertainty concerning the resale of the reprocessed plastic. The environmental benefits from an increase in recycling of plastic waste are: Reduced emissions of CO 2 from waste incineration Reused and recycled plastic will replace the use of fossil raw materials to create virgin plastic In 2013, the Danish government published a strategy for better use of resources, Denmark without waste, based on similar policy paper from the EU. This strategy focuses on the quality of recycling.

4 4/27 The tender is also conducted in the light of the European Commission s Circular Economy Package and the revision of the EU Directive on Waste, and the EU Directive on Packaging and Packaging Waste. Here, the European Commission has proposed significantly higher targets for reuse and recycling and new rules on the calculation of the attainment of the targets. 1.2 Purpose CLEAN has taken the initiative to conduct an innovative procurement procedure in cooperation with other public stakeholders. The procedure aims to develop an innovative plastic sorting and reprocessing solution for household plastic waste and similar types of industrial plastic waste from commercial enterprises. The main purpose of the procurement procedure is to identify an innovative solution to the use of resources from plastic waste in a circular economy perspective. Important requirements for this solution is that it should improve on the current solutions so that plastic waste can be reused and recycled at a price, quality and in a quantity that is actually attractive to companies that use reprocessed plastic in their production. Since the waste stream also includes a mixed plastic and metal fraction from household, the solution must be able to separate the plastic and metal fractions. It is also a requirement that the solution is attractive to the Contracting Authorities and waste management companies that supply plastic waste, in terms of price and quality. 2. 24 24/ Award of contract 10.1 Award criteria The contract will be awarded based on the award criterion best price quality ratio on the basis of the following sub-criteria: Costs (30-50%) Quality (30-50%) Legal and financial elements (10-30%) 10.2 Evaluation of costs CLEAN will evaluate the final tenders in relation to the sub-criterion costs based on the total price based on the estimated quantities of plastic waste Evaluation of qualitative sub-criteria Point scale for qualitative sub-criteria CLEAN will award a number of points for the qualitative sub-criteria on an scale from 0 to 10 where 0 is the lowest possible score and 10 is the highest possible score. CLEAN will award points individually on the basis of an assessment of the degree of fulfilment of each sub-criterion. It is therefore possible that no final tender will be awarded maximum points, just as 2 or more final tenders may be awarded the same number of points for a sub-criterion Evaluation of quality In relation to the sub-criterion quality, CLEAN will attach special importance to that the plastic waste is sorted and separated into individual polymers in a quality that can be reused or recycled and thereby replace the use of virgin plastic. In addition, CLEAN will also attach special importance to the rate (quantity) of the plastic waste that is prepared for reuse or recycled instead of other means of recovery operations, including energy recovery. CLEAN will also attach special importance to that the economic operator will ensure a high level of transparency through the entire process and supply-chain by

25 25/27 effective means for quality control, traceability in the waste stream, supervision and audits. Finally, CLEAN will also emphasise that there is a safe and healthy work environment where manual handling of waste materials is minimised and the proportion of equipment to be used that is powered by energy from renewable sources in accordance with Directive 2009/28/EC on the promotion of the use of energy from renewable sources and amending and subsequently repealing Directives 2001/77/EC and 2003/30/EC Evaluation of legal and financial elements In relation to the sub-criterion legal and financial elements, CLEAN will attach special importance to that the economic operator will assume obligations to invest in innovation and implementing new technology or methods of operation during the contract period in order to improve the performance and the overall environmental outcome. In addition, CLEAN will attach special importance to that the contractual obligations of the Contracting Authorities are minimised and that the economic operator offers to reduce the prices for the treatment of plastic waste during the contract period. CLEAN will also emphasise that the economic operator offers an organisation with simple and direct lines of communication with the Contracting Authorities and where the key persons have the necessary educational and professional qualifications. In addition, CLEAN will also emphasise that the average distance of transport of plastic waste (based on the quantities and addresses in Appendix 2:) from the Contracting Authorities to the economic operator s treatment facility is minimised. Finally, CLEAN will emphasise that the economic operator offers a high level of flexibility in the ways that the Contracting Authorities can deliver the plastic waste Combination of costs and qualitative sub-criteria For the combination of costs and qualitative sub-criteria, CLEAN will use a calculation model where the awarded points for the qualitative sub-criteria are converted into costs supplements on the basis of the average costs of the received final tenders.

26 26/27 Afterwards, the costs and the costs supplements of each final tender are added up to a total evaluation price. The costs supplements and the total evaluation price are calculated figures for the use of the evaluation alone. The average costs is the mean value of the costs in the received final tenders. The costs supplements of each qualitative sub-criterion is calculated using the following: Costs supplements = Average costs / 10 * (10 awarded points for the qualitative sub-criteria) * Weight of qualitative sub-criteria The total evaluation price is calculated using the following: Total evaluation price = (Costs * Weight of costs) + Costs supplements 1 + Costs supplements 2 + [ ] The final tender with the lowest total evaluation price is deemed as having the best price quality ratio Documentation Before CLEAN decides to award the contract, the tenderer to which CLEAN intends to award the contract must present any updated or otherwise necessary documentation of the information provided before selection, cf. section The economic operator must also present documentation that no identified subcontractor in the final tender is subject to the grounds for exclusion, cf. section 7.6, in accordance with section 152 of the Public Procurement Act Information regarding award of contract CLEAN will inform all economic operators involved simultaneously and in writing of the decisions made regarding award of contract.
